Title: Yoichi Mikami: Innovator in Magnetic Recording Technology

Introduction

Yoichi Mikami is a prominent inventor based in Kyoto, Japan. He is known for his contributions to the field of magnetic recording technology. With a focus on innovation, Mikami has developed significant advancements that have impacted the industry.

Latest Patents

Mikami holds a patent for a magnetic recording medium and the process for its production. This invention represents a crucial development in the efficiency and effectiveness of magnetic recording technologies. He has 1 patent to his name, showcasing his expertise in this specialized area.

Career Highlights

Mikami is associated with Sekisui Kagaku Kogyo Kabushiki Kaisha, a company recognized for its advancements in chemical and material technologies. His work at this organization has allowed him to contribute to innovative solutions in magnetic recording.

Collaborations

Throughout his career, Mikami has collaborated with notable colleagues, including Toshinori Takagi and Shinsaku Nakata. These partnerships have fostered a creative environment that encourages the development of groundbreaking technologies.
